AuroraWare! Summary| AuroraWare! is a collection of visual accessories. These programs are simple, yet helpful, windows applications. Many of the programs optionally operate as topmost windows, which remain visible when other applications are active. Each program can be activated numerous times. All of these programs are accompanied by HTML usage descriptions. The following programs are provided: | |

C h e c k L s t
The CheckList accessory is an easy to use activity list management system. It uses a standard text file to store list items. When an item is checked, the date and time of the activity's completion are added to the front of the item. The order of activity items can be easily rearranged. Completed items can be optionally automatically archived when the activity list is saved. |

T i c k e r
The Ticker accessory shows the current date and time in the upper right corner of the monitor. The displayed text can be copied to the clipboard by pressing a button. Alternatively, you can select portions of the text with the mouse, then right click the text area, and select 'Copy'. |

T o p C l i c k
The TopClick accessory is useful for numerous purposes. Generally, it is used to perform a frequent system command. Another common usage is to copy a text string to the clipboard. A specific program can be established as the program to perform when the action button is pressed. The TOPCLICK program can operate as a 'topmost' window. |

T o p C l i p
The TopClip accessory is an easy to use text clipping management system. Clippings are commonly typed text segments. These are retained in a standard text file. The names of clippings are retained in a standard drop-down list. These are presented in alphabetic order. Clippings are added by pressing the Add button, and entering the text in the clipping text input area. Text can also be added to the input area by pasting text that is currently in the system clipboard. |

T o p C u e
The TopCue accessory shows a text file as a scrolling marquee note. The cue can optionally be displayed as a topmost window, which remains visible when other windows are active. The intent is to show a reminder, at a specific time of day, or when the computer is started. |

T o p L i s t
The TopList accessory is useful for numerous purposes. It can be used to merely maintain an ordered list of items. Generally, it is used to hold a list of system commands. Often, it contains a list of file names to activate with an associated program. A specific program can be established as the program to activate for a list item. |

T o p N o t e
The TopNote accessory provides many useful note editing capabilities. The simplest usage is to retain commonly used text segments in a scrapbook, for copying and pasting to other applications. An important capability is to view the note as a 'topmost' window. This allows you to see note contents while other applications are active. |

T o p S o r t
The TopSort accessory sorts the text in the system clipboard. Various sorting options are supported. Clipboard contents are displayed in a read-only text area. Clipboard text is sorted when TopSort is started, and after options are modified. The text is automatically copied to the clipboard after every sort operation. |

V u H t m l
The VuHtml accessory is used to view HTML files or URLs. It is particularly useful for displaying HTML files that use the Microsoft Internet Explorer dialog capabilities; especially when the HTML text contains JavaScript programs. Many useful accessories can be developed using VUHTML with Dynamic HTML programs. |
